Old-time music compiled by R. Crumb and John Heneghan from their own collections. Crumb's emergence the birth of underground comics with Crumb as it's most recognizable force. Crumb owns almost five thousand 78 RPM records in his collection. In the liner notes, Heneghan writes, "So what I'm saying is, during the late 1920's and early 1930's in America, a treasure trove of rich rural music was recorded, before marketing maniacs could get there ghastly, grubby hands on it. As a result we have a true glimpse into what rural American music was and what it sounded like in all it's raw distinctive nature. In the early 78 rpm era, countless records were recorded by some of the most unique sounding musicians and bands which never would've made it past the audition process once marketing ideas were set firmly in place by record companies to make music the most profitable. It's a strong experience to hear music made by the people, for the people, from a time when big money was just getting involved in the music making process and hadn't yet fully crushed or cast out the most unique and richest sounding performers of the time. As a result we are left with, in my opinion, recordings of some of the most beautiful music ever made. I guess that's what old-time music is to me." Includes a multi-page booklet with beautiful photographs of early 20th century musicians and liner notes by Heneghan and Tony Russell. Cover photo from the collection of R. Crumb with layout and hand-drawn text by R. Crumb.
